Her cheeks were flushed with pleasure.

She held in her lap a pretty little golden vase.

Her clever fingers were passing over it rapidly, exactly as they had passed, the previous evening, over my face.
"Shall I tell you what the pattern is on your vase ?" she went on.
"Can you really do that ?" "You shall judge for yourself.

The pattern is made of leaves, with birds placed among them, at intervals.

Stop! I think I have felt leaves like these on the old side of the rectory, against the wall.
